温馨提示:这篇文章已超过239天没有更新,请注意相关的内容是否还可用!
使用ajax时,如果调用发生错误,可能会导致网页崩溃。这种错误通常是由于网络问题、服务器问题或代码错误引起的。在ajax调用发生错误时,我们可以通过错误处理机制来处理这些错误,以避免网页崩溃。
示例代码如下:
$.ajax({
url: "example.com/api/data",
method: "GET",
success: function(response) {
// 处理成功返回的数据
},
error: function(xhr, status, error) {
// 处理错误
}
});
在上述示例代码中,我们使用jQuery的ajax方法发起一个GET请求。如果请求成功,success回调函数将被调用,我们可以在其中处理返回的数据。如果请求发生错误,error回调函数将被调用。
在error回调函数中,我们可以根据具体的错误情况进行处理。例如,我们可以在控制台输出错误信息,或者显示一个友好的错误提示给用户。这样,即使ajax调用发生错误,我们仍然可以优雅地处理错误,而不会导致网页崩溃。
使用ajax时,如果调用发生错误,我们可以通过错误处理机制来处理这些错误,以避免网页崩溃。通过在error回调函数中处理错误,我们可以根据具体的错误情况进行相应的处理,保证用户体验的同时提供错误信息。
文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。